Hallo Leute.
Bin etwas frustriert. Ich bin dabei, eine
XML-Klasse für mich zu schreiben. Ich dachte, wenn in einmal eine habe, kann ich immer ganz einfach mit
XML arbeiten.
Nur mein Problem ist jetzt das Auslesen einer
XML Struktur. Das sollte bei einer Klasse ja allgemein gehalten sein. Ich möchte mich nicht immer an eine bestimmte Ebenentiefe binden, sondern völlig dynamisch alles auslesen können.
Mir schein es an den Grundstrukturen von
XML zu fehlen. Ich weis zb nicht genau, wie man an einzelne Nodes / Attribute rankommt. Muss ich mich da durchhangeln, oder gibt's da was einfareres.
Auch weis ich nicht, was "documentElement" bedeutet. Lese ich das aus, mit der .text-Funktion, dann bekomme ich alle Einträge aus der
XML-Datei. Hier mal ein Beispiel
XML-Code:
<?
xml version="1.0" encoding="ISO-8859-1"?>
<filmdatenbank>
<dvds>
<movie>
<id>1</id>
<name>Der Schuh des Manitu</name>
</movie>
<movie>
<id>3</id>
<name>Scary Movie</name>
</movie>
</dvds>
<mvcds>
<movie>
<id>2</id>
<name>Dr. Dolittle</name>
</movie>
</mvcds>
</filmdatenbank>
Ich bekomme bei Documentelement.text
Code:
1 Der Schuch des Manitu 3 Scary Movie 2 Dr.Dolittle
Ich hatte eher "filmdatenbank" oder von mir aus "dvds" erwartet.
Bitte helft mir oder gebt mir ein gutes Tutorial. Dankeschön!